Effect of palatoplasty on speech, dental occlusion issues and upper dental arch in children and adolescents with cleft palate: an integrative literature review

ABSTRACT

Purpose:

to compile acquired knowledge related to speech, maxillary growth, dental arch and dental occlusion issues of subjects with cleft palate (associated or not with cleft lip), relating them to the found structural and morphological changes, along with time of surgery and surgical technique employed in palatoplasty.

Methods:

a search was carried out on four databases, namely: PubMed, SciELO, LILACS and MEDLINE, between May and August, 2018. The following descriptors, in Portuguese and in their corresponding terms in English, were used: cleft palate, speech, oral surgery or palatoplasty, teeth or dental arch.

Results:

altogether, 92 articles were found in the four databases. Eleven articles met the established selection criteria, thus, included in this review. According to the findings, the palatoplasty surgical technique influences speech, maxillary growth and dental occlusal issues; however, it is still unclear which technique is more beneficial to the subjects with cleft palate.

Conclusion:

results found in these 11 studies are divergent in regard to the surgical technique which most favors the development of speech, dental arches and maxillary growth. Therefore, it is important that new researches be carried out relating the aspects of speech, facial growth, dental occlusion and dental arch in the subjects with cleft palate, to the technique and the time of palatoplasty.

Introduction

The cleft palate (CP) is characterized by the incomplete fusion of the palatine processes happening still in the intrauterine life, between the fourth and twelfth week of pregnancy. This type of cleft is also called post-incisive foramen cleft and may involve different parts of the palate, occurring either totally or partially; it is described according to its extension11. Methods

The initial step in the development of this review was to formulate the research question: “What is the effect of palatoplasty on speech, dental occlusion issues and upper dental arch measurements in children with cleft palate?” This integrative review used both nationally and internationally published articles1616. Mendes KDS, Silveira RCCP, Galvão CM. Integrative literature review: a research method to incorporate evidence in health care and nursing. Texto Contexto Enferm. 2008;17(4):758-64..

The following databases were used for this review: PubMed, SciELO (Scientific Electronic Library Online), LILACS (Latin American and Caribbean Literature on Health Sciences), and MEDLINE (Medical Literature Analysis and Retrieval System Online), as they include the majority of the publications on the subject. A manual search was associated with it, going through the references in the selected articles in order to identify other studies that might be included in the review. The articles were researched between May and August, 2018.

The search descriptors, in accordance with the “Health Science Descriptors” (DeCS, from the acronym in Portuguese), were: cleft palate, speech, oral surgery, palatoplasty, teeth, dental arch. The research used the following relation of terms: cleft palate AND (teeth OR dental arch) AND speech AND (oral surgery OR palatoplasty). The search was carried out in Portuguese; in the English language databases, the corresponding English terms were used, as well as the mutual combinations with Boolean operators AND or OR, in accordance with the Medical Subject Headings (MeSH).

Longitudinal and cross-sectional original articles, as well as case series, were analyzed. Certain text types were excluded, namely: opinion articles, editorials, systematic reviews, case reports and dissertations. The selection of articles had the following inclusion criteria: studies dealing with traditional or experimental palatoplasty techniques; researches whose subjects, either having isolated cleft palate or associated with cleft lip, underwent palatoplasty; researches that presented results related to the upper dental arch (and/or teeth) of subjects with CP, either with or without speech as a secondary outcome; articles published between 2000 and 2018. The exclusion criteria were: researches whose patients had cleft palate associated with syndromes or neurological alterations; studies duplicated in different databases; studies repeated in different languages; review articles; theses; dissertations; editorials; and those whose texts were not available in its entirety.

Pigott et al.1818. Pigott RW, Albery EH, Hathorn IS, Atack NE, Williams A, Harland K et al. A comparison of three methods of repairing the hard palate. Cleft Palate Craniofac J. 2002;39(4):383-91. compared three surgical techniques, namely: Cuthbert Veau, von Langenbeck, and medial Langenbeck (performed between 3 and 6 months of age). In this study, 66 children with UCLP were submitted to speech assessment at 5 years of age, in average. In the research, maxillary growth and articulation pattern improved significantly after palate repair. However, nasal symmetry and velopharyngeal function were not changed1818. Pigott RW, Albery EH, Hathorn IS, Atack NE, Williams A, Harland K et al. A comparison of three methods of repairing the hard palate. Cleft Palate Craniofac J. 2002;39(4):383-91.. Regarding nasal air emission, nasal resonance or pharyngoplasty performed later on, no significant differences were reported between the three palatoplasty techniques1818. Pigott RW, Albery EH, Hathorn IS, Atack NE, Williams A, Harland K et al. A comparison of three methods of repairing the hard palate. Cleft Palate Craniofac J. 2002;39(4):383-91.. Nevertheless, concerning nasal air emission, Von Langenbeck technique presented better results (77% of the subjects without nasal air emissions) when compared to medial Langenbeck technique (54% of the subjects without nasal air emission)1818. Pigott RW, Albery EH, Hathorn IS, Atack NE, Williams A, Harland K et al. A comparison of three methods of repairing the hard palate. Cleft Palate Craniofac J. 2002;39(4):383-91.. Von Langenbeck technique presented a greater number of children with normal articulation (40.9%), in comparison to medial Langenbeck technique (27.3%) and Cuthbert Veau (18.2%), without statistically significant difference1818. Pigott RW, Albery EH, Hathorn IS, Atack NE, Williams A, Harland K et al. A comparison of three methods of repairing the hard palate. Cleft Palate Craniofac J. 2002;39(4):383-91.. In the subjects with normal articulation and phonological alteration or immaturity (alterations not related to the cleft, according to the authors), the medial Langenbeck technique presented better results (68.2%) than Von Langenbeck (45.5%) and Cuthbert Veau (22.7%)1818. Pigott RW, Albery EH, Hathorn IS, Atack NE, Williams A, Harland K et al. A comparison of three methods of repairing the hard palate. Cleft Palate Craniofac J. 2002;39(4):383-91..

Speech, Dental Arch and Palatoplasty

The occurrence of articulation errors in subjects with CP is related to the shape of the dental arch and the morphology of the hard palate1010. Ito S, Noguchi M, Suda Y, Yamaguchi A, Kohama G, Yamamoto E. Speech evaluation and dental arch shape following pushback palatoplasty in cleft palate patients: supraperiosteal flap technique versus mucoperiosteal flap technique. J Craniomaxillofac Surg. 2006;34(3):135-43.. In mixed dentition stage, palatalized articulation occurs in patients with smaller anterior palatine volume, linguoversion teeth and reduced possibility of growth2121. Oyama T, Sunakawa H, Arakaki K, Shinya T, Tengan T, Hiratsuka H et al. Articulation disorders associated with maxillary growth after attainment of normal articulation after primary palatoplasty for cleft palate.Ann Plast Surg. 2002;48(2):138-47..

Subjects who presented palatalized articulation disorders present anterior palatine volume and total palatine volume significantly smaller than those with normal articulation2121. Oyama T, Sunakawa H, Arakaki K, Shinya T, Tengan T, Hiratsuka H et al. Articulation disorders associated with maxillary growth after attainment of normal articulation after primary palatoplasty for cleft palate.Ann Plast Surg. 2002;48(2):138-47.. Although both groups present an increase in central palatine width with the increase of maxillary growth, the palatine area decreased a little in the group with palatalization, but increased significantly in the group with normal articulation2121. Oyama T, Sunakawa H, Arakaki K, Shinya T, Tengan T, Hiratsuka H et al. Articulation disorders associated with maxillary growth after attainment of normal articulation after primary palatoplasty for cleft palate.Ann Plast Surg. 2002;48(2):138-47.. Linguoversion teeth are more frequently found in subjects with palatalized articulation disorder, thus suggesting that this position of the teeth may provoke palatalization as it restricts the movements of the tip of the tongue2121. Oyama T, Sunakawa H, Arakaki K, Shinya T, Tengan T, Hiratsuka H et al. Articulation disorders associated with maxillary growth after attainment of normal articulation after primary palatoplasty for cleft palate.Ann Plast Surg. 2002;48(2):138-47..

Conclusion

Although CP is a condition found worldwide, there are few reports in the literature relating aspects of speech, maxillary growth, upper dental arch and dental occlusion issues to palatoplasty, in this type of cleft alone.

Concerning speech, it may be inferred that one- and two-stage palatoplasty presented diverging results, according to this study. Therefore, further studies are necessary in order to compare just these two techniques, without the interference of other factors. In addition, pushback palatoplasty employing supraperiosteal technique presented satisfactory results regarding articulation disorders, when compared to the mucoperiosteal one. Nonetheless, the findings cannot be generalized, due to the restricted amount of studies, as well as the different protocols used.

Maxillary growth may be influenced by the timing and technique of the surgery. In the consulted literature, no technique has been presented with superiorly positive results in all evaluated dimensions of maxillary growth. However, regarding the upper dental arch and dental occlusion issues, it may be concluded that there is a tendency to lower rates of palatal narrowing and anterior crossbite resulting from two-stage palatoplasty - even though it is not possible to assert (because of diverging results and methodologies in the studies) that this palatoplasty technique is the best in cases of CP. More analyses in this population are necessary.

Lastly, based on the findings of this literature review, which resulted in 11 articles meeting the pre-established selection criteria (in accordance with the terms and combinations used in the research), it may be concluded that the palatoplasty surgical technique influences speech, maxillary growth, upper dental arch and dental occlusion issues. Notwithstanding, there is a need for more researches relating palatoplasty (when the surgery was performed and which surgical technique was employed) to aspects of speech, maxillary growth, upper dental arch and dental occlusion issues in subjects with CP, centered on longitudinal studies.
